KATHMANDU: Prime Minister (PM) Pushpa Kamal Dahal Prachanda has called an emergency cabinet meeting.

Prime Minister Dahal called an emergency meeting of the Council of Ministers while expressing grief over the tragic incident of Yeti Airlines crash in Pokhara on Sunday morning.

The aircraft, which was flying from Kathmandu to Pokhara with 72 people, including four crew members, crashed near Pokhara Airport.

Expressing grief over the accident, Prachanda has directed the Ministry of Home Affairs, security personnel, and all agencies of the Nepalese government to carry out effective rescue operations.
